Torsten Bringmann is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Statistical and Nonlinear Physics. According to data from OpenAlex, Torsten Bringmann has authored 69 papers receiving a total of 3.4k indexed citations (citations by other indexed papers that have themselves been cited), including 65 papers in Nuclear and High Energy Physics, 48 papers in Astronomy and Astrophysics and 3 papers in Statistical and Nonlinear Physics. Recurrent topics in Torsten Bringmann's work include Dark Matter and Cosmic Phenomena (62 papers), Cosmology and Gravitation Theories (46 papers) and Particle physics theoretical and experimental studies (36 papers). Torsten Bringmann is often cited by papers focused on Dark Matter and Cosmic Phenomena (62 papers), Cosmology and Gravitation Theories (46 papers) and Particle physics theoretical and experimental studies (36 papers). Torsten Bringmann collaborates with scholars based in Germany, Norway and Sweden. Torsten Bringmann's co-authors include Lars Bergström, Christoph Pfrommer, Christoph Weniger, Maxim Pospelov, Joakim Edsjö, M. Gustafsson, Kai Schmidt-Hoberg, Martin Eriksson, Mark Vogelsberger and Jesús Zavala and has published in prestigious journals such as Physical Review Letters, Monthly Notices of the Royal Astronomical Society and Physics Letters B.
